Chloroplast, SEM
Chloroplast. Coloured scanning electron micrograph (SEM) of a section through a plant cell, showing a fractured chloroplast (green). Chloroplasts are the site of photosynthesis, the process that synthesises carbohydrates from carbon dioxide and water using sunlight. The pigment responsible for photosynthesis, chlorophyll, is found on stacks of parallel thylakoids (membranes, brown) called grana

This print showcases the intricate beauty of a chloroplast, captured through a coloured scanning electron microscope (SEM). The image reveals a fractured chloroplast in vibrant green, highlighting its significance as the powerhouse of photosynthesis within plant cells. Chloroplasts play a crucial role in synthesizing carbohydrates from carbon dioxide and water using sunlight. The stacks of parallel thylakoids, seen here in brown membranes called grana, are adorned with the pigment responsible for photosynthesis - chlorophyll. These pigments absorb light energy to initiate the chemical reactions that convert sunlight into usable energy. The false-coloured SEM image provides an extraordinary glimpse into the inner workings of this organelle. It offers us insight into plant anatomy and biology by showcasing various components such as grains, stroma, plastids, and membranous structures. By freezing this fracture sectioned sample and examining it under an electron microscope, scientists have unraveled the complex architecture of chloroplasts. This photograph not only captures their delicate structure but also emphasizes their vital role in sustaining life on Earth through oxygen production and carbohydrate synthesis.
